What is the best fencing material for North Catasauqua's conditions?
Material selection must address moderate soil corrosivity and termite risk. Galvanized steel posts are recommended for corrosion resistance. For wood components, pressure-treated lumber rated for ground contact is mandatory. Use stainless steel or hot-dip galvanized fasteners to prevent rust streaks and premature failure.
How is my fence designed to handle high winds?
The design uses the V-ult wind speed of 115 MPH. This ultimate wind load dictates post spacing, concrete footing mass, and bracket strength. Engineering per ASCE 7-22 standards ensures the structure can survive peak storm season gusts without catastrophic failure or becoming a projectile.
Why do fence post footings need to be so deep in North Catasauqua?
The frost line depth is 42 inches. Footings installed above this line are subject to frost heave, which lifts posts and destroys fence alignment. All footing designs for North Catasauqua Borough must meet IRC R403.1.4 requirements for frost protection to ensure structural stability.

Can I install a smart gate on a fence around a pool?
Yes, but security integration must comply with pool safety code. The barrier must meet IRC Appendix AG standards, including a 48-inch minimum height and self-closing, self-latching gates. Modern IoT latches can integrate with these requirements, providing automated monitoring that meets current liability standards for Pennsylvania homeowners.
What are the height and placement rules for a fence on my property?
Zoning limits are 3 feet in the front yard and 6 feet in the rear yard. The setback regulation is 0 feet, meaning you can build on the property line. Corner lots require special attention to 'sight triangles' for driver visibility, especially near high-traffic corridors like PA-145.
What is required before digging fence post holes?
You must contact Pennsylvania 811 for utility locates. Hitting a gas, electric, or fiber line in North Catasauqua Borough is a major liability event that incurs repair costs and fines.
